Any well documented format and style for filenames and directories is acceptable, although CODAS format is preferred. Courtesy of the E.Firing "Currents" Laboratory at the University of Hawai, one may obtain the complete CODAS software and manual , which provides processing, editing, and calibrating of the raw data sets fresh off the ship. This software is also necessary to read data sets stored in the CODAS format.
Metadata (information about the data) are vital for the archive. The CLIVAR SADCP DAC provides a guideline (blank form), an example (completed form), and specific instructions for completing the form. If it is too much a burden to fill in the described form, and such information is available in a separate document, please just send or point to this document.
